# Description
reading the [frontpage of the standard
library](https://github.com/nushell/nushell/blob/main/crates/nu-std/README.md#--welcome-to-the-standard-library-of-nushell--)
and according to the last Nushell meeting, i has been agreed that `std
clip` does not belong to the standard library 😮
- it is not written in pure Nushell and requires external dependencies
which might not even work properly as in
#11041
- it is not a building block to build more complex applications

this PR deprecates the `std clip` command in favor of [`modules/system
clip`](nushell/nu_scripts#674) for now.

the `std clip` command will be removed in Nushell 0.89.
